From: Devin Heitmueller <devin.heitmueller@ltnglobal.com>

Rework the code a bit to speed up the 10-bit bitpacked decoding
routine.  This is probably about as fast as I can get it without
switching to assembly language.

Demonstratable with:

./ffmpeg -f lavfi -i "smptehdbars=size=3840x2160" -c bitpacked -f image2 -frames:v 1 source.yuv
./ffmpeg -f bitpacked -pix_fmt yuv422p10le -s 3840x2160 -c:v bitpacked -i source.yuv -pix_fmt yuv422p10le out.yuv

On my development system, it went from 80ms for a 2160p frame
down to 20ms (i.e. a 4X speedup).  Good enough for now, I hope...

Comments from Marton:

Originally on my system better performance could be achieved by simply
switching to the cached bitstream reader, but for Devin it was slower than
his direct byte operations.

I changed the order of writing output from u/y/v/y to u/v/y/y, and that made
the code faster than the cached bitstream reader on my system as well.

TIMER measurement of the decode loop on Ryzen 5 3600 with command line:

./ffmpeg -stream_loop 256 -threads 1 -f bitpacked -pix_fmt yuv422p10le -s 3840x2160 -c:v bitpacked -i source.yuv -pix_fmt yuv422p10le -f null none -loglevel error

Before: 823204127 decicycles in YUV,     256 runs,      0 skips
After:  315070524 decicycles in YUV,     256 runs,      0 skips

Patch

diff --git a/libavcodec/bitpacked_dec.c b/libavcodec/bitpacked_dec.c
index c88f861993..54c008bd86 100644
--- a/libavcodec/bitpacked_dec.c
+++ b/libavcodec/bitpacked_dec.c
@@ -28,7 +28,6 @@ 
 
 #include "avcodec.h"
 #include "codec_internal.h"
-#include "get_bits.h"
 #include "libavutil/imgutils.h"
 #include "thread.h"
 
@@ -65,7 +64,7 @@  static int bitpacked_decode_yuv422p10(AVCodecContext *avctx, AVFrame *frame,
 {
     uint64_t frame_size = (uint64_t)avctx->width * (uint64_t)avctx->height * 20;
     uint64_t packet_size = (uint64_t)avpkt->size * 8;
-    GetBitContext bc;
+    uint8_t *src;
     uint16_t *y, *u, *v;
     int ret, i, j;
 
@@ -79,20 +78,18 @@  static int bitpacked_decode_yuv422p10(AVCodecContext *avctx, AVFrame *frame,
     if (avctx->width % 2)
         return AVERROR_PATCHWELCOME;
 
-    ret = init_get_bits(&bc, avpkt->data, avctx->width * avctx->height * 20);
-    if (ret)
-        return ret;
-
+    src = avpkt->data;
     for (i = 0; i < avctx->height; i++) {
         y = (uint16_t*)(frame->data[0] + i * frame->linesize[0]);
         u = (uint16_t*)(frame->data[1] + i * frame->linesize[1]);
         v = (uint16_t*)(frame->data[2] + i * frame->linesize[2]);
 
         for (j = 0; j < avctx->width; j += 2) {
-            *u++ = get_bits(&bc, 10);
-            *y++ = get_bits(&bc, 10);
-            *v++ = get_bits(&bc, 10);
-            *y++ = get_bits(&bc, 10);
+            *u++ = (src[0] << 2) | (src[1] >> 6);
+            *v++ = ((src[2] << 6) | (src[3] >> 2)) & 0x3ff;
+            *y++ = ((src[1] << 4) | (src[2] >> 4)) & 0x3ff;
+            *y++ = ((src[3] << 8) | (src[4]))      & 0x3ff;
+            src += 5;
         }
     }
